I’m installing the GM Stepper motor cruise.

There are two different sets of instructions… one references the VSS input as being “square sine wave” and the other as sine wave (analog).

Any idea which is correct?

One if the local car guys came up with a VSS from a Camaro.

In the vise, spun it with a drill with a Oscilloscope on the output.

It’s a sine wave.

I’m using the Dakota Digital buffer box, so I have the outputs that I need for the EBL and the cruise.

I’m going to put the coach back on the dyno next month. It’s running great closed loop, but I want to tweak the mapping. I think it’s rich open loop. The first run in the fall was a challenge. The dyno has a separate O2 sensor that is generally put in the tailpipe. It has a vacuum pump (venturi) to bring the gasses in, but the long exhaust system on the coach was a problem timing wise. I’ll likely drop the collector on one of the headers for the next run.
